Question 1 Continuity eqn is A1V1=A2V2 which means volume flow rate is constant.Then how volume flow rate is changed when a water tap is turned or controlled(ie when Area is changed)? In Physics Asked by: Maria Jose, on Oct 19, 2012 Ans. the volume flow rate remians same just the speed of the flow is changed.

Expert Answer:
the concept that the volume flow remains constant because we assume that the fluid is incompressible
so the fluid comeing in has to go out with the same volume rate as it is not being stored anywhere
